Know what you want from an agency
Before you start looking for marketing agencies, you should determine what you want from them. Do you want them to create a marketing plan for your business, or do you want them to execute the plan? Once you know what you want, it will be easier to find an agency that is a good fit for you. There are three main types of agencies you can choose from: There are also hybrids of these types of agencies, and depending on which type you choose, the services will vary.
- Full-Service Agencies - A full-service agency can help with everything from creating a marketing plan to implementing it. They may also help with long-term marketing strategies like creating a branding campaign. Full-service agencies can be helpful for businesses that want to create a long-term marketing strategy. They can help create and execute a marketing plan to help you reach your goals. Full-service marketing agencies can help with many things, but they may not be the best choice for certain types of businesses. If you want the agency to create your marketing plan for you, or if you want the agency to help you with short-term marketing, then a full-service agency may be a good fit.
- Specialized Agencies - Specialized marketing agencies focus on a specific type of marketing, such as digital marketing or B2B marketing. These agencies often have years of experience in their niche, so they can be helpful for specific needs. Specialized agencies can be helpful if you want help with a specific marketing need, such as creating an online ad or designing a logo. For example, if you want help creating a digital marketing strategy, then a specialized agency may be a good fit for you. Digital marketing, such as social media and website traffic, can be expensive. Specialized agencies often have contacts in the industry and will know who will provide you with the best service at the best price.
- Boutique Agencies - Boutique marketing agencies offer a wide variety of marketing services, but they don’t have the resources that other agencies have. Large agencies may have departments dedicated to specific tasks, while boutique agencies have a smaller team and don’t have dedicated departments.
